['umi-plugin-pro-block',{}], ], } Options { moveMock:false,//whether move _mock.js to mock, default to true moveService:false,//whether move service.js to src/services/, default to true modifyRequest:false,//whether modify umi-request to util(s)/request (if it exist), default to...
🧐 问题描述 旧版本的v4 可以通过config.ts 中 umi-plugin-pro-block 改变moveMock等flag信息,新版本中没有找到修改覆盖配置的地方。 💻 示例代码 .umirc.ts 或 config/config.ts 中配置项目和插件,尝试没有成功 moveMock: false, moveService: false, modifyRequest:
exportdefault{plugins:[['umi-plugin-pro-block',{}],],} Options {moveMock:false,// whether move _mock.js to mock, default to truemoveService:false,// whether move service.js to src/services/, default to truemodifyRequest:false,// whether modify umi-request to util(s)/request (if it...
首先介绍命令行创建项目 执行以下命令开始创建项目 代码语言:javascript 代码运行次数:0 运行 AI代码解释 npm creat umi 可以选择以下几个项目 project,通用项目脚手架,支持选择是否启用TypeScript,以及umi-plugin-react包含的功能 ant-design-pro,仅包含ant-design-pro布局的脚手架,具体页面可通过umi block添加 block,...
initPlugin (D:\Pansoft\fmis-apps\main\node_modules\umi\node_modules\@umijs\core\dist\service\service.js:346:40) at Service.run (D:\Pansoft\fmis-apps\main\node_modules\umi\node_modules\@umijs\core\dist\service\service.js:223:18) at processTicksAndRejections (node:internal/process/task_...
npm run getblocks 忽略区块 在.gitignore中添加如下: # blocks blocks 添加插件 在命令行中使用命令: yarn add umi-plugin-pro-block@1.3.2 该插件的功能是:https://www.npmjs.com/package/umi-plugin-pro-block 控制区块的请求方法是否和本项目一致 ...
$ yarn add umi-plugin-electron-builder -dev umi4需要手动启用插件 import{defineConfig}from"umi";exportdefaultdefineConfig({npmClient:"yarn",plugins:["umi-plugin-electron-pro"],}); 配置完成之后,执行 $ yarn postinstall 执行以下指令,生成主进程文件 src/main/index.ts ...
onOptionChange = fn; }; apply(api, opts); plugin._api = api; } } } 在整套插件的执行过程中,umi 首先会 service.reslovePlugins 方法解析获得插件,并挂载 api 执行上下文;然后在 service.run 方法调用期间,umi 会调用 service.initPlugins 方法调用插件注册钩子、命令等,然后再从通过注册生成的 service...
1 是项目中新增 plugin.ts,会默认作为插件添加,方便项目进行一些插件级的扩展;2 是调试问题时通常需要修改编译后的代码看看有没有改对,你把 umi.js 下下来存到项目根目录,umi 会优先使用这份代码。 以上是 Umi 4 目前的部分新功能。 除此之外,还有一些计划在正式版发布之前做的事情。包括 api route、umi ...
// https://umijs.org/zh-CN/plugins/plugin-locale locale:{// default zh-CN default:'zh-CN', antd: true, // default true, when it is true, will use`navigator.language`overwrite default baseNavigator: true,}, dynamicImport:{loading:'@ant-design/pro-layout/es/PageLoading',}, ...